Rs 2 crore financial aid for family of stampede victim
Actor Allu Arjun and the production team behind the film Pushpa today announced a financial aid of Rs 2 crore for the family of a woman who tragically lost her life in a stampede during a screening of the film on December 4. In a show of support, Allu Arjun’s father, veteran producer Allu Aravind, along with prominent producer Dil Raju and others, visited a private hospital where an injured boy from the incident is currently receiving treatment.
Allu Aravind expressed his relief after speaking with the medical staff, who reported that the boy is recovering and is now able to breathe independently. The doctors remain optimistic about his full recovery. Additionally, Dil Raju, chairman of the Telangana State Film Development Corporation (FDC), announced that a group of film industry representatives will meet with Telangana Chief Minister A Revanth Reddy on Thursday to promote positive relations between the government and the film sector.
